NVIDIA today announced that it will be hosting another GTC keynote for the coming month of October. To be held between October 5th and October 9th, the now announced keynote will bring updates to NVIDIA's products and technologies, as well as provide an opportunity for numerous computer science companies and individuals to take center stage on discussing new and upcoming technologies. More than 500 sessions will form the backbone of GTC, with seven separate programming streams running across North America, Europe, Israel, India, Taiwan, Japan and Korea - each with access to live demos, specialized content, local startups and sponsors.
This GTC keynote follows the May 2020 keynote where the world was presented to NVIDIA's Ampere-based GA100 accelerator. A gaming and consumer-oriented event is also taking place on September 1st, with expectations being set high for NVIDIA's next-generation of consumer graphics products. Although if recent rumors of a $2,000 RTX 3090 graphics card are anything to go by, not only expectations will be soaring by then.
